you don't drink it neat!!

The acid would make a mess of your oesophagus and stomach linings!

I think 1 recommended dose that I saw when I was googling it earlier was 1 tsp (or was it 1 tbsp?) in a LARGE glass of water, and that was to be drunk slowly over 2 meals.

I can't remember what I tried, I think it was 1 tsp in a glass ..... but I know it wasn't pleasant tasting and didn't seem to do any good!

Only the naturopath / homeopath sites recommended drinking it. Any site with any medical knowledge said any good effects were "not proven".

Mind you, they did say it wouldn't do any harm, as long as you didn't drink it neat or in large amounts.
